<BR>Need advice, Last yr nov 99 I started a new job (produce) which required me to leave town for 5 month and be away from my family for the 1st time. My wife was having a diffcult time with this but was trying not to show this to me. She started to depend on her girlfriends for company. <P>This started the down fall when it was my schedule weekend off to come home (every 3wks) she wasn't there for me. This then became a problem for me trying to deal with my wife going out with friends and me on the road driving home 9 hrs to only come home to an empty house. <P>I expressed my feeling about this and told her when it was my shedule weekend to come home for her to please be there for me.<BR>I told her I needed her to be here for me while I was in town to spend that quality time together (as a family). She advised me she was enjoying her new passion going out with the girls and getting a break from the kids. <P>When I got back in mar 2000 things had already changed even more and the communication between the 2 of us was gone. I started to express my feelings for a co-worker which in turn (also having martial problems) we turned together for confort. I only kiss this person but was ready to go further with this. <P>In July my wife read one of my email I sent to the OW, there I had stated about getting together with her in hotel room that weekend. My wife was so upset and angry and was ready to boot me out. I explained to her what was happening and that I really didn't want to be with this OW, but that my wife of 8yrs was not longer there for me. <P>I was crying out for her and she was to involed with her friends to see what was coming. We are trying consuling but she said she not ready to forgive me with all of this right now, she want a separation. I advised her I was leaving again next month (4mnts) hopefully this will give her time to sort out what she wants in this marriage. <P>I am not the most patients person in the world but I have to do what ever it takes to get my wife back. I have given her what she wants (her space) to be out with her girlfriends, but I feel one of them is encourage her to leave me (she also is separated from her H who also cheated on her).<P>She is now going out and not coming home till the next day. I want to believe her that she is spending the night with friends but in the back of my mind I feel there is someone else in the picture.
